Wheel interchange depends on more than bolt pattern. Where data is available, this site compares:
A normal wheel spacer does not change bolt pattern. Hub rings cannot enlarge a wheel bore that is smaller than the hub. Brake clearance and tire package fitment still require vehicle-specific checks when not confirmed in the dataset.
The values below reflect one documented factory configuration. Trim, brake package, and wheel option packages can change specifications. If your CTS differs, use the on-page calculator and confirm with your door-jamb tire placard, the owner’s manual, or a Cadillac dealer by VIN.
| Bolt pattern (studs x PCD) | 5x120 |
| Center bore | 66.9 mm |
| Thread size | M14 x 1.5 |
| Rim diameter | 19 in |
| Rim width | 8.5 in |
| Wheel offset (ET) | 34 mm |
| Backspacing | 5.59 in |
| Tire section width | 245 mm |
| Tire aspect ratio | 45 |
| Tire rim diameter | 17 in |

What is the bolt pattern on a 2017 Cadillac CTS?
5x120.
What center bore do I need?
66.9 mm. If your aftermarket wheel has a larger bore, use 66.9 mm ID hub-centric rings. A smaller bore will not fit.
What lug nut thread size does the CTS use?
M14 x 1.5. Match lug seat style to the wheel design and torque to the OEM spec listed in your owner’s manual.
Why do the listed wheel and tire sizes show 19 inch wheels and a 17 inch tire example?
The 2017 CTS was offered with multiple packages. The values above reflect known data points from different trims. Confirm your exact OEM size using the tire placard and compare options with the calculator.
Will different offsets fit my CTS?
Possibly. The OEM reference here is ET 34 mm. Use the calculator to see inner clearance to suspension and outer poke to fenders, then test-fit before driving.
Can I run spacers?
Use only quality hub-centric spacers and ensure proper thread engagement or use extended hardware. Recheck torque after installation. Verify legality and warranty implications.
How do I keep overall tire diameter close to stock when plus sizing?
As you increase rim diameter, reduce tire aspect ratio. Use the calculator to keep overall diameter within a small variance and verify clearance at full lock and compression.
How do I verify the correct torque spec?
Check the owner’s manual or OEM service information for your exact trim and wheel option. Do not guess.
